What Are Faux Wood Blinds?
Faux wood blinds offer the classic look of real wood with enhanced durability and moisture resistance. Made from PVC materials, these window treatments provide stylish appearance without extra maintenance. They're distinguished by horizontal slat size, with 2" and 2 1/2" options available.
Wider slats provide a modern feel, while narrower slats create a traditional look. Standard cordless lift systems offer convenience for families.
Benefits of Faux Wood Blinds
Faux wood blinds stand up to humidity better than genuine wood, making them ideal for bathroom blinds and kitchens. They're more durable than real wood blinds and don't warp or fade over time.

Important Considerations
Faux wood is heavier than genuine wood, which means larger window treatments can be difficult to install or operate. While faux wood resembles genuine wood, it's not an exact match.

How to Measure and Install
Measure carefully before ordering your custom faux wood blinds. Measure width at top, middle, and bottom using the narrowest dimension.
Measure height at left, middle, and right using the tallest measurement.

Cleaning and Maintenance
Cleaning faux wood blinds is simple with a dry dusting cloth or warm, soapy water. Don't use abrasive cleaners as they could damage the finish.
The durable PVC material resists moisture and won't warp or fade.
